No comprendo este código. Por favor, explíquenmelo
Publicado por Paquito (7 intervenciones) el 14/04/2017 19:46:55
Soy un novato en Javascript y estoy haciendo un curso en CodeCademy ( https://www.codecademy.com/learn/web ).
Hasta ahora, me voy defendiendo. Me está costando, pero me defiendo.
Sin embargo, a veces hay códigos que no comprendo. Seguro que vosotros os parecerá poco menos que infantil este que os pongo aquí, pero necesito saber cómo funciona de forma exacta.
Por más vueltas que le doy, no le encuentro la lógica del todo.
El código, es este:
Comprendo parte de él, pero no comprendo cómo es capaz de "encontrar" el número mayor.
Saludos y desde ya, gracias!.
Hasta ahora, me voy defendiendo. Me está costando, pero me defiendo.
Sin embargo, a veces hay códigos que no comprendo. Seguro que vosotros os parecerá poco menos que infantil este que os pongo aquí, pero necesito saber cómo funciona de forma exacta.
Por más vueltas que le doy, no le encuentro la lógica del todo.
El código, es este: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
<html><head>
<meta content="text/html; charset=ISO-8859-1" http-equiv="content-type"><title>PlantillaJScript</title>
<script type="text/javascript">
var arreglo = [11 , 6, 2, 56, 32, 115, 89, 32];
var mayor = 0;
for (var i=0; i<arreglo.length ;i++)
{
if(arreglo[i]>mayor)
{
mayor=arreglo[i];
}
}
document.write(mayor);
</script>
</head><body><div style="text-align: left;">
<br>
PlantillaJS</div>
</body>
</html>
Comprendo parte de él, pero no comprendo cómo es capaz de "encontrar" el número mayor.
Saludos y desde ya, gracias!.
Valora esta pregunta


0